I love when books grab my interest on page 1 and this book did just that and kept me engaged til the end. Story centers on a 9 year old Starla, who runs away from home after 1 too many punishments from her grammie, to find her momma , who she thinks is a famous singer in Nashville. Everything happens during the racial unrest in the south in the early 60's. Along her way she is befriended by Eula, a poor black woman, who becomes a substitute mother to Starla and gets her to her mom in Nashville after lots of twists and turns. Enjoyable read!! Recommend!
